mirror of
https://github.com/gryf/wmaker.git
synced 2025-12-20 21:08:08 +01:00
Fix the use of uinptr_t
Remove the additional cast to (int), as that makes no sense.
This commit is contained in:
@@ -36,7 +36,7 @@ void show(WMWidget * self, void *data)
|
|||||||
void *d;
|
void *d;
|
||||||
WMLabel *l = (WMLabel *) data;
|
WMLabel *l = (WMLabel *) data;
|
||||||
d = WMGetHangedData(self);
|
d = WMGetHangedData(self);
|
||||||
sprintf(buf, "%i - 0x%x - 0%o", (int)(uintptr_t) d, (int)(uintptr_t) d, (int)(uintptr_t) d);
|
sprintf(buf, "%i - 0x%x - 0%o", (int)d, (int)d, (int)d);
|
||||||
WMSetLabelText(l, buf);
|
WMSetLabelText(l, buf);
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|||||||
@@ -134,7 +134,7 @@ void buttonClick(WMWidget * w, void *ptr)
|
|||||||
{
|
{
|
||||||
char buffer[300];
|
char buffer[300];
|
||||||
|
|
||||||
if (SlideButton((int)(uintptr_t) ptr)) {
|
if (SlideButton((uintptr_t)ptr)) {
|
||||||
MoveCount++;
|
MoveCount++;
|
||||||
|
|
||||||
if (CheckWin()) {
|
if (CheckWin()) {
|
||||||
|
|||||||
@@ -36,7 +36,7 @@ void *valueForCell(WMTableViewDelegate * self, WMTableColumn * column, int row)
|
|||||||
col2[i] = 0;
|
col2[i] = 0;
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
if ((int)(uintptr_t) WMGetTableColumnId(column) == 1)
|
if ((uintptr_t)WMGetTableColumnId(column) == 1)
|
||||||
return col1[row];
|
return col1[row];
|
||||||
else
|
else
|
||||||
return (void *)(uintptr_t) col2[row];
|
return (void *)(uintptr_t) col2[row];
|
||||||
@@ -44,10 +44,10 @@ void *valueForCell(WMTableViewDelegate * self, WMTableColumn * column, int row)
|
|||||||
|
|
||||||
void setValueForCell(WMTableViewDelegate * self, WMTableColumn * column, int row, void *data)
|
void setValueForCell(WMTableViewDelegate * self, WMTableColumn * column, int row, void *data)
|
||||||
{
|
{
|
||||||
if ((int)(uintptr_t) WMGetTableColumnId(column) == 1)
|
if ((uintptr_t)WMGetTableColumnId(column) == 1)
|
||||||
col1[row] = data;
|
col1[row] = data;
|
||||||
else
|
else
|
||||||
col2[row] = (int)(uintptr_t) data;
|
col2[row] = (uintptr_t) data;
|
||||||
}
|
}
|
||||||
|
|
||||||
static WMTableViewDelegate delegate = {
|
static WMTableViewDelegate delegate = {
|
||||||
|
|||||||
@@ -192,7 +192,7 @@ static void ESCellPainter(WMTableColumnDelegate * self, WMTableColumn * column,
|
|||||||
{
|
{
|
||||||
EnumSelectorData *strdata = (EnumSelectorData *) self->data;
|
EnumSelectorData *strdata = (EnumSelectorData *) self->data;
|
||||||
WMTableView *table = WMGetTableColumnTableView(column);
|
WMTableView *table = WMGetTableColumnTableView(column);
|
||||||
int i = (int)(uintptr_t) WMTableViewDataForCell(table, column, row);
|
uintptr_t i = (uintptr_t)WMTableViewDataForCell(table, column, row);
|
||||||
|
|
||||||
stringDraw(WMWidgetScreen(table), d,
|
stringDraw(WMWidgetScreen(table), d,
|
||||||
strdata->gc, strdata->selGC, strdata->textColor, strdata->font,
|
strdata->gc, strdata->selGC, strdata->textColor, strdata->font,
|
||||||
@@ -203,7 +203,7 @@ static void selectedESCellPainter(WMTableColumnDelegate * self, WMTableColumn *
|
|||||||
{
|
{
|
||||||
EnumSelectorData *strdata = (EnumSelectorData *) self->data;
|
EnumSelectorData *strdata = (EnumSelectorData *) self->data;
|
||||||
WMTableView *table = WMGetTableColumnTableView(column);
|
WMTableView *table = WMGetTableColumnTableView(column);
|
||||||
int i = (int)(uintptr_t) WMTableViewDataForCell(table, column, row);
|
uintptr_t i = (uintptr_t)WMTableViewDataForCell(table, column, row);
|
||||||
|
|
||||||
stringDraw(WMWidgetScreen(table), d,
|
stringDraw(WMWidgetScreen(table), d,
|
||||||
strdata->gc, strdata->selGC, strdata->textColor, strdata->font,
|
strdata->gc, strdata->selGC, strdata->textColor, strdata->font,
|
||||||
@@ -214,7 +214,7 @@ static void beginESCellEdit(WMTableColumnDelegate * self, WMTableColumn * column
|
|||||||
{
|
{
|
||||||
EnumSelectorData *strdata = (EnumSelectorData *) self->data;
|
EnumSelectorData *strdata = (EnumSelectorData *) self->data;
|
||||||
WMRect rect = WMTableViewRectForCell(strdata->table, column, row);
|
WMRect rect = WMTableViewRectForCell(strdata->table, column, row);
|
||||||
int data = (int)(uintptr_t) WMTableViewDataForCell(strdata->table, column, row);
|
uintptr_t data = (uintptr_t)WMTableViewDataForCell(strdata->table, column, row);
|
||||||
|
|
||||||
wassertr(data < strdata->count);
|
wassertr(data < strdata->count);
|
||||||
|
|
||||||
@@ -285,7 +285,7 @@ static void BSCellPainter(WMTableColumnDelegate * self, WMTableColumn * column,
|
|||||||
{
|
{
|
||||||
BooleanSwitchData *strdata = (BooleanSwitchData *) self->data;
|
BooleanSwitchData *strdata = (BooleanSwitchData *) self->data;
|
||||||
WMTableView *table = WMGetTableColumnTableView(column);
|
WMTableView *table = WMGetTableColumnTableView(column);
|
||||||
int i = (int)(uintptr_t) WMTableViewDataForCell(table, column, row);
|
uintptr_t i = (uintptr_t)WMTableViewDataForCell(table, column, row);
|
||||||
WMScreen *scr = WMWidgetScreen(table);
|
WMScreen *scr = WMWidgetScreen(table);
|
||||||
|
|
||||||
if (i) {
|
if (i) {
|
||||||
@@ -302,7 +302,7 @@ static void selectedBSCellPainter(WMTableColumnDelegate * self, WMTableColumn *
|
|||||||
{
|
{
|
||||||
BooleanSwitchData *strdata = (BooleanSwitchData *) self->data;
|
BooleanSwitchData *strdata = (BooleanSwitchData *) self->data;
|
||||||
WMTableView *table = WMGetTableColumnTableView(column);
|
WMTableView *table = WMGetTableColumnTableView(column);
|
||||||
int i = (int)(uintptr_t) WMTableViewDataForCell(table, column, row);
|
uintptr_t i = (uintptr_t)WMTableViewDataForCell(table, column, row);
|
||||||
WMScreen *scr = WMWidgetScreen(table);
|
WMScreen *scr = WMWidgetScreen(table);
|
||||||
|
|
||||||
if (i) {
|
if (i) {
|
||||||
@@ -319,7 +319,7 @@ static void beginBSCellEdit(WMTableColumnDelegate * self, WMTableColumn * column
|
|||||||
{
|
{
|
||||||
BooleanSwitchData *strdata = (BooleanSwitchData *) self->data;
|
BooleanSwitchData *strdata = (BooleanSwitchData *) self->data;
|
||||||
WMRect rect = WMTableViewRectForCell(strdata->table, column, row);
|
WMRect rect = WMTableViewRectForCell(strdata->table, column, row);
|
||||||
int data = (int)(uintptr_t) WMTableViewDataForCell(strdata->table, column, row);
|
uintptr_t data = (uintptr_t)WMTableViewDataForCell(strdata->table, column, row);
|
||||||
|
|
||||||
WMSetButtonSelected(strdata->widget, data);
|
WMSetButtonSelected(strdata->widget, data);
|
||||||
WMMoveWidget(strdata->widget, rect.pos.x + 1, rect.pos.y + 1);
|
WMMoveWidget(strdata->widget, rect.pos.x + 1, rect.pos.y + 1);
|
||||||
|
|||||||
@@ -118,13 +118,14 @@ static void textChangedObserver(void *observerData, WMNotification * notificatio
|
|||||||
char *text;
|
char *text;
|
||||||
WMList *list;
|
WMList *list;
|
||||||
int col = WMGetBrowserNumberOfColumns(panel->browser) - 1;
|
int col = WMGetBrowserNumberOfColumns(panel->browser) - 1;
|
||||||
int i, textEvent;
|
int i;
|
||||||
|
uintptr_t textEvent;
|
||||||
|
|
||||||
if (!(list = WMGetBrowserListInColumn(panel->browser, col)))
|
if (!(list = WMGetBrowserListInColumn(panel->browser, col)))
|
||||||
return;
|
return;
|
||||||
|
|
||||||
text = WMGetTextFieldText(panel->fileField);
|
text = WMGetTextFieldText(panel->fileField);
|
||||||
textEvent = (int)(uintptr_t) WMGetNotificationClientData(notification);
|
textEvent = (uintptr_t)WMGetNotificationClientData(notification);
|
||||||
|
|
||||||
if (panel->flags.autoCompletion && textEvent != WMDeleteTextEvent)
|
if (panel->flags.autoCompletion && textEvent != WMDeleteTextEvent)
|
||||||
i = closestListItem(list, text, False);
|
i = closestListItem(list, text, False);
|
||||||
@@ -157,7 +158,7 @@ static void textEditedObserver(void *observerData, WMNotification * notification
|
|||||||
{
|
{
|
||||||
W_FilePanel *panel = (W_FilePanel *) observerData;
|
W_FilePanel *panel = (W_FilePanel *) observerData;
|
||||||
|
|
||||||
if ((int)(uintptr_t) WMGetNotificationClientData(notification) == WMReturnTextMovement) {
|
if ((uintptr_t)WMGetNotificationClientData(notification) == WMReturnTextMovement) {
|
||||||
WMPerformButtonClick(panel->okButton);
|
WMPerformButtonClick(panel->okButton);
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|||||||
@@ -686,8 +686,8 @@ static void typefaceClick(WMWidget * w, void *data)
|
|||||||
WMClearList(panel->sizLs);
|
WMClearList(panel->sizLs);
|
||||||
|
|
||||||
WM_ITERATE_ARRAY(face->sizes, size, i) {
|
WM_ITERATE_ARRAY(face->sizes, size, i) {
|
||||||
if ((int)(uintptr_t) size != 0) {
|
if ((uintptr_t)size != 0) {
|
||||||
sprintf(buffer, "%i", (int)(uintptr_t) size);
|
sprintf(buffer, "%li", (uintptr_t)size);
|
||||||
|
|
||||||
WMAddListItem(panel->sizLs, buffer);
|
WMAddListItem(panel->sizLs, buffer);
|
||||||
}
|
}
|
||||||
@@ -782,8 +782,8 @@ static void setFontPanelFontName(FontPanel * panel, char *family, char *style, d
|
|||||||
|
|
||||||
WM_ITERATE_ARRAY(face->sizes, vsize, i) {
|
WM_ITERATE_ARRAY(face->sizes, vsize, i) {
|
||||||
char buffer[32];
|
char buffer[32];
|
||||||
if ((int)(uintptr_t) vsize != 0) {
|
if ((uintptr_t)vsize != 0) {
|
||||||
sprintf(buffer, "%i", (int)(uintptr_t) vsize);
|
sprintf(buffer, "%li", (uintptr_t)vsize);
|
||||||
|
|
||||||
WMAddListItem(panel->sizLs, buffer);
|
WMAddListItem(panel->sizLs, buffer);
|
||||||
}
|
}
|
||||||
|
|||||||
@@ -317,7 +317,7 @@ static void endedEditingObserver(void *observerData, WMNotification * notificati
|
|||||||
{
|
{
|
||||||
WMInputPanel *panel = (WMInputPanel *) observerData;
|
WMInputPanel *panel = (WMInputPanel *) observerData;
|
||||||
|
|
||||||
switch ((int)(uintptr_t) WMGetNotificationClientData(notification)) {
|
switch ((uintptr_t)WMGetNotificationClientData(notification)) {
|
||||||
case WMReturnTextMovement:
|
case WMReturnTextMovement:
|
||||||
if (panel->defBtn)
|
if (panel->defBtn)
|
||||||
WMPerformButtonClick(panel->defBtn);
|
WMPerformButtonClick(panel->defBtn);
|
||||||
|
|||||||
@@ -829,14 +829,14 @@ static void stopEditItem(WEditMenu * menu, Bool apply)
|
|||||||
static void textEndedEditing(struct WMTextFieldDelegate *self, WMNotification * notif)
|
static void textEndedEditing(struct WMTextFieldDelegate *self, WMNotification * notif)
|
||||||
{
|
{
|
||||||
WEditMenu *menu = (WEditMenu *) self->data;
|
WEditMenu *menu = (WEditMenu *) self->data;
|
||||||
int reason;
|
uintptr_t reason;
|
||||||
int i;
|
int i;
|
||||||
WEditMenuItem *item;
|
WEditMenuItem *item;
|
||||||
|
|
||||||
if (!menu->flags.isEditing)
|
if (!menu->flags.isEditing)
|
||||||
return;
|
return;
|
||||||
|
|
||||||
reason = (int)(uintptr_t) WMGetNotificationClientData(notif);
|
reason = (uintptr_t)WMGetNotificationClientData(notif);
|
||||||
|
|
||||||
switch (reason) {
|
switch (reason) {
|
||||||
case WMEscapeTextMovement:
|
case WMEscapeTextMovement:
|
||||||
|
|||||||
@@ -62,7 +62,7 @@ static void miniwindowDblClick(WObjDescriptor * desc, XEvent * event);
|
|||||||
static void appearanceObserver(void *self, WMNotification * notif)
|
static void appearanceObserver(void *self, WMNotification * notif)
|
||||||
{
|
{
|
||||||
WIcon *icon = (WIcon *) self;
|
WIcon *icon = (WIcon *) self;
|
||||||
int flags = (int)(uintptr_t) WMGetNotificationClientData(notif);
|
uintptr_t flags = (uintptr_t)WMGetNotificationClientData(notif);
|
||||||
|
|
||||||
if (flags & WTextureSettings) {
|
if (flags & WTextureSettings) {
|
||||||
icon->force_paint = 1;
|
icon->force_paint = 1;
|
||||||
|
|||||||
@@ -93,7 +93,7 @@ static void closeCascade(WMenu * menu);
|
|||||||
static void appearanceObserver(void *self, WMNotification * notif)
|
static void appearanceObserver(void *self, WMNotification * notif)
|
||||||
{
|
{
|
||||||
WMenu *menu = (WMenu *) self;
|
WMenu *menu = (WMenu *) self;
|
||||||
int flags = (int)(uintptr_t) WMGetNotificationClientData(notif);
|
uintptr_t flags = (uintptr_t)WMGetNotificationClientData(notif);
|
||||||
|
|
||||||
if (!menu->flags.realized)
|
if (!menu->flags.realized)
|
||||||
return;
|
return;
|
||||||
|
|||||||
@@ -417,7 +417,7 @@ static void wsobserver(void *self, WMNotification * notif)
|
|||||||
void *data = WMGetNotificationClientData(notif);
|
void *data = WMGetNotificationClientData(notif);
|
||||||
|
|
||||||
if (strcmp(name, WMNWorkspaceNameChanged) == 0) {
|
if (strcmp(name, WMNWorkspaceNameChanged) == 0) {
|
||||||
UpdateSwitchMenuWorkspace(scr, (int)(uintptr_t) data);
|
UpdateSwitchMenuWorkspace(scr, (uintptr_t)data);
|
||||||
} else if (strcmp(name, WMNWorkspaceChanged) == 0) {
|
} else if (strcmp(name, WMNWorkspaceChanged) == 0) {
|
||||||
|
|
||||||
}
|
}
|
||||||
|
|||||||
@@ -129,7 +129,7 @@ static void resizebarMouseDown(WCoreWindow * sender, void *data, XEvent * event)
|
|||||||
static void appearanceObserver(void *self, WMNotification * notif)
|
static void appearanceObserver(void *self, WMNotification * notif)
|
||||||
{
|
{
|
||||||
WWindow *wwin = (WWindow *) self;
|
WWindow *wwin = (WWindow *) self;
|
||||||
int flags = (int)(uintptr_t) WMGetNotificationClientData(notif);
|
uintptr_t flags = (uintptr_t)WMGetNotificationClientData(notif);
|
||||||
|
|
||||||
if (!wwin->frame || (!wwin->frame->titlebar && !wwin->frame->resizebar))
|
if (!wwin->frame || (!wwin->frame->titlebar && !wwin->frame->resizebar))
|
||||||
return;
|
return;
|
||||||
|
|||||||
Reference in New Issue
Block a user